Do I need a special license to rent an RV in Beggs, Oklahoma?

Good news: a regular driver's license is all you need to rent an RV in Beggs. Oklahoma does not require a Commercial Driver's License (CDL) for motorhomes, travel trailers, fifth wheels, or campervans used for personal recreational travel, even for larger Class A rigs. On RVezy, approved drivers are generally 25 or older with a valid license, and your ID is verified through the platform during booking. Visiting from abroad? Bring an International Driving Permit (IDP) along with your home license. Most first-time renters are surprised at how simple the licensing piece really is.

Where are the best campgrounds near Beggs for RV camping?

You've got fantastic options for RV camping near Beggs within an hour's drive. Okmulgee State Park (about 15 minutes south) offers lakeside sites with electric hookups and great fishing on Okmulgee Lake. Heyburn Park Campground on Heyburn Lake (about 30 minutes northwest) is a US Army Corps of Engineers park with electric sites and year-round access for big rigs. Keystone State Park near Mannford (about an hour northwest) offers full hookups and sandy beaches on Keystone Lake. Several private RV parks around Beggs and nearby Okmulgee provide full hookups and easy US-75 access. Book Oklahoma State Park sites through the official Oklahoma State Parks reservation system several months ahead for the best selection.

When is the best time of year for an RV trip from Beggs, Oklahoma?

Beggs sits in a humid subtropical climate with a long camping season. April through early June and September through early November are the sweet spots: daytime highs in the 70s and low 80s, cool nights, and wildflowers or fall colors at their peak. Summer is hot and humid with average highs in the low 90s (great if you want the lake, less great for sleeping without strong air conditioning), and spring brings Oklahoma's famous severe weather, so watch the forecast carefully from April through May. Winter trips are generally mild with average lows in the low to mid 30s and only a few inches of snow annually, making shoulder seasons the smart-money pick for RV rental Oklahoma.

What kind of fuel mileage should I expect, and what's gas like around Beggs?

Budget-wise, Oklahoma is one of the friendlier states for RV travel, with gas prices typically running below the national average. Expect roughly 8 to 10 MPG for a Class A motorhome, 10 to 14 MPG for a Class C, and 12 to 16 MPG when towing a travel trailer with a midsize truck. Campervan rental Beggs options like Class B vans usually return 16 to 20 MPG. QuikTrip and Love's Travel Stops along US-75 and the Indian Nation Turnpike are RV-friendly with big pull-throughs. Pro tip: fill up in Beggs or Okmulgee before heading into more rural southeastern Oklahoma, where stations get sparse.

How far in advance should I book a campground near Beggs?

For the best selection, reserve Oklahoma State Park RV sites three to four months ahead through the official Oklahoma State Parks reservation system, especially for summer weekends and any holiday near Tulsa. Spots like Keystone State Park and Sequoyah State Park book up first because they're within an hour of the city. Heyburn Park and Okmulgee State Park typically have more last-minute availability midweek. Memorial Day, July 4th, and Labor Day weekends fill up fastest, so set a reminder. Pro tip: many private RV parks right in Beggs or nearby Okmulgee take walk-ins or short-notice bookings if state park sites are full.

What are driving conditions like around Beggs?

Driving an RV around Beggs is refreshingly easy, with mostly flat-to-rolling terrain, wide rural roads, and light traffic outside of Tulsa rush hour. US-75 is the main north-south corridor and handles big rigs comfortably. The biggest local consideration is weather: Oklahoma sits in Tornado Alley, with spring storms (April to early June) sometimes producing hail and high winds, so check the National Weather Service Tulsa forecast each morning and know your campground's storm shelter location. Summer afternoon heat can also be intense, so plan longer drives for early morning. Avoid taking large Class A motorhomes through downtown Tulsa during weekday rush hours; loop around on the Creek Turnpike instead.

What amenities do campgrounds near Beggs offer?

Campgrounds near Beggs are well set up for RVs, with most state and Corps of Engineers parks offering 30/50-amp electric, water hookups, dump stations, hot showers, and flush toilets. Okmulgee State Park, Heyburn Park, and Keystone State Park all have dump stations for registered campers, plus boat ramps and swimming areas on their lakes. For dedicated full hookups (water, electric, sewer at site), look at private parks around Beggs or closer to Tulsa. Pro tip: if you're heading out for a few days of boondocking on a Wildlife Management Area, top off fresh water and dump before leaving, since rural eastern Oklahoma has fewer service points.

Where can I dump waste and fill fresh water near Beggs?

Easy peasy: Oklahoma State Parks near Beggs have dump stations and potable water fills available for registered campers. Okmulgee State Park (about 15 minutes south), Heyburn Park (about 30 minutes northwest), and Keystone State Park (about an hour northwest) are the most convenient. Many Love's Travel Stops and Flying J locations along I-44 and US-75, including in Sapulpa and Henryetta, offer RV dump service for a small fee and are typically open 24/7. Pro tip: dump at the end of every campground stay rather than waiting until tanks are full, especially in hot weather, your nose will thank you on the drive home.
